Most programmes stop at training. We go further with our accredited landscape program: Learn practical skills, work on real projects, and access youth employment opportunities. Discover South Africa's landscape as you don’t just train—you build a future.
1. Training (Weeks 1–4)
Gain core skills in landscaping through our accredited landscape program, focusing on plant care, irrigation, and safety.
2. Work Experience (Weeks 5–12)
Engage in hands-on projects at schools, cooperatives, and community sites, providing valuable landscaping training.
3. Income Pathways (Weeks 13–24)
Join work teams that deliver paid services, creating youth employment opportunities while helping to build a greener community.
